The Lease and Telco accounting team is currently seeking a senior accountant. The ideal candidate will be a team player with a solid foundation in accounting and strong technical, analytical, and problem-solving skills. Core functions will include monthly close responsibilities, ad hoc analysis, SOX and financial audit compliance, process improvement, and other projects. This position will work with finance and operations teams throughout the company including Network Engineering, Retail, Real Estate and IT to ensure operating expenses, assets and liabilities are properly reported.
What you'll do in your role.
- Assist in the monthly close process, including preparation of journal entries, reconciling complex general ledger accounts, and performing trend analysis.
- Understand business drivers and their effect on financial results to ensure business changes are accurately reflected in the financial statements and communicated to business partners.
- Ensure compliance in meeting SOX requirements.
- Ensure that effective internal controls are developed and performed.
- Provide support for the audits performed by internal and external auditors.
- Assist in creating ad hoc and monthly reports from multiple sources as needed.
- Proactively identify risks and opportunities for improvements within the lease accounting systems and processes and recommend solutions.
- Use accounting concepts, wide-ranging experience, analytical skills, and knowledge of industry to identify and resolve issues in creative and effective ways.
- Actively participate in cross-functional projects to thoroughly understand the potential impacts on Accounting and our business partners, represent our needs/requirements and ensure implementation is successful.
The experience you'll bring.
- Strong understanding of accounting theory and accounting systems; SAP experience a plus
- Excellent interpersonal, decision-making and analytical abilities
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ills and ability to communicate effectively with different levels within the organization
- Strong organizational and time management skills and the ability to balance a large group of diverse projects simultaneously with excellent attention to detail
- Ability to resolve complex problems positively and professionally with minimal supervision
- Ability to manipulate large volumes of data from multiple systems
- Proficient in Excel
- Alteryx experience preferred
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ting or CPA required
- Telecommunication industry experience preferred
- 5+ years of relevant accounting experience, preferably within a large company accounting environment or 3+ years public accounting experience
